"Road to Recovery"  24' x 30'  2008

By Paul D.


Paul is a brain injury survivor and an active participant of the Fine Arts Program, engrossed in drawing and painting. He is a quiet, thoughtful, humorous fellow in his early thirties who may surprise one with a wry comment at any moment. He always enjoyed art back to his early school days and remembers, with pride, that his high school art teacher purchased his paintings.

Paul often depicts landscape images as well as portraits. His paintings have an ethereal, spacious, open quality as if air is moving through them. He also draws and paints intriguing abstract images as exemplified here. While he enjoys both acrylic and watercolor painting, he is an exceptional watercolorist who employs the negative white space of his images most effectively. He participates regularly in community-based exhibitions such as the Muddy Cup Gallery in Kingston and the Ellenville Hospital and Library Galleries.
